"When someone achieves greatness in any field-such as the arts, science, politics, or business-that person's achievements are more important than any of his or her personal faults
MY RESPONSE
An underlying desire to achieve greatness is what pushes many individuals to work as hard as they possibly can, harness the powers of their talent and not miss an opportunity when it is presented to them. Some people achieve greatness, however many do not and today's society places great importance on celebrities and studies their every move. While some people argue that those who achieve greatness have a responsibility to be model citizens and ideal examples for their admirers. In today's world, nobody is perfect and on an issue as subjective as a personal shortcoming there are bound to be differing views. The people who require achievers to be perfect in every sense, overlook the fact that after all, these achievers are human. It is for this reason that I agree wholeheartedly with the issue raised and will substantiate this stance over the following paragraphs.
Perfection is the ultimate goal for us all, after all who would not want to play football like David Beckam or play tennis like Steffi Graf? Or sing like Frank Sinatra or Madonna? Maybe paint like Leonardo da Vinci and write like Shakespeare? The entertainment world has long admired the talents of Charlie Chaplin and Marilyn Monroe. However all these celebrities and great achievers have had personal faults. This is not a coincidence but a stark reminder that these achievers are human after all. The people who long and demand that the achievers in society be flawless are inherently flawed themselves. It is for this reason that we should place emphasis on their actual achievements and not nitpick at every single step of the way while delving into their personal affairs.
In essence, we should look at who has benefited from their achievements. Have they changed the lives of many? Much has been made about the personal shortcomings of the entertainer Michael Jackson, however millions of people over the years derived joy from watching him perform. He broke boundaries by becoming the first African American to be featured extensively on MTV, thus paving the way for future performers. He inspired thousands to take up dancing and choreography and have successful careers. His music, dedication and passion have inspired millions as evidenced by the outburst of sympathy following his tragic death. Yet while he was alive, he was under the magnifying glass and constantly criticised. While his celebrity no doubt led to his eccentric behaviour, the world would be a poorer place without his achievements.
That is not to say that there does not exist a line beyond which certain behaviour is acceptable. If a celebrity commits murder, he or she should be held responsible and judged according to the laws of the land. But within reason I strongly agree that achievements of the great citizens of our time are more important than their personal faults.
